Pakistan urges Bangladesh to demonstrate spirit of reconciliation

PakistanPakistan urges Bangladesh to demonstrate spirit of reconciliation

ISLAMABAD, Pakistan: Taking note of baseless charges against a Pakistani diplomat in Bangladesh, Pakistan Thursday once again urged the Government of Bangladesh to demonstrate the spirit of reconciliation and forward looking approach enshrined in the 1974 Tripartite Agreement.       

Miss Farina Arshad, Second Secretary at Pakistan High Commission in Dhaka, was constantly being harassed by the Bangladeshi authorities.

The Government of Pakistan twice summoned the High Commissioner of Bangladesh and a strong protest was lodged against the treatment meted out to her, the Foreign Office spokesman said in a statement issued here.

Lately, an incessant and orchestrated media campaign was launched against her on spurious charges linking her with so-called terrorists, the statement said, adding, “Our High Commission in Dhaka issued a strong rebuttal against the baseless and fabricated charges against the diplomat.”

“Following this protest, it was decided to withdraw her. She has since returned back,” the statement added.
